About the Role

Walton Medical Centre are looking for an individual to join our busy team as a prescription clerk/pharmacy assistant help make a positive impact on our local communityThe hours for this role are flexible and we will consider both full and part hours. 

Duties will include;
 
  • Undertaking processing patient prescription requests.
    • Ensuring that requests for repeat prescriptions are actioned appropriately.
    • Responding to all queries and requests from patients, chemists, nursing homes and district nurses, regarding the issue of prescriptions.
    • Keeping repeat prescription information up-to-date in patient records.
    • Sending out medication review invites.
    • Organising blood tests (through ICE system) or blood pressure checks for patients, relevant to their prescribing needs.
    • General ad hoc administration work.
    • Keep up-to-date with all prescribing guidelines and protocols, relevant to the position.

About Us

The Colte Partnership is very much ‘At The Heart of Primary Care’, being the largest GP Partnership in North East Essex; comprised of 8 local GP practices across Colchester and Tendring. We care for approx. 80,000 patients. Our Head Office is in Feering.

We pride ourselves on working to be at the forefront of Primary Care in our region and have many exciting ventures on the horizon.

Each of our branches has its own character, and family friendly ethos, which is why our patients love coming to us (and tell us so in our regular patient surveys). However, being a large partnership means we can offer so much more than a local branch can by itself – with specialist clinics, social prescribing and innovative support such as regular dementia cafes, armed forces support and even child first aid classes for parents.

 We strive to look after our employees as well, with generous annual leave, flexible and family friendly working, and support during difficult times such as free counselling.

We also work as a collaborative Primary Care Networks (PCN’s) which span across Colchester and Tendring.
